- 博客(30)
- 资源 (3)
- 收藏
- 关注
原创 [JAVA报错]-Web server failed to start. Port *** was already in use.
报这错就是端口占用,给端口先杀了再起就可以。先开始菜单-运行-输入cmdnetstat -aon|findstr 你的端口号例如上面那个图里就是netstat -aon|findstr 9004tasklist|findstr 红框里数字例如上面那个图里就是tasklist|findstr 390966在启动就行了......
2022-02-14 15:21:14
563
原创 IDEA操作快捷键
从eclipse到IDEA好久了但是还是记不住IDEA的快捷键,每次都得重新查太麻烦,写一个备忘录吧1.垂直选择、竖向选择用以下方法后能看见右下角多个“列”字,这个时候就是可以鼠标竖向选了。方1:右键点击列选择模式(不汉化就是:Column Selection Mode)方2:按alt +shift+insert2.替换:Ctrl+r3.实体类生成getter、setter:alt+insert...
2022-01-19 14:10:48
697
原创 poi导出Excel
需求是根据传输的数据生成个Excel,在把Excel传到别的接口,所以对格式没有太高要求,有格式要求的可以在单独搜一下相关格式。本例中导出的为.xls,有大数据量导出需求的可以导出.xlsx,把文中HSSFWorkbook换为SXSSFWorkbook即可一、引入maven <dependency> <groupId>org.apache.poi</groupId> <artifactId>poi-ooxml</artifac.
2022-01-19 13:05:41
831
原创 POI导出EXCEL报错
不能解决符号 ‘ALIGN_CENTER’把:cellStyle.setAlignment(HSSFCellStyle.ALIGN_CENTER);改成:cellStyle.setAlignment(HorizontalAlignment.CENTER);不能解决符号 ‘VERTICAL_CENTER’把:cellStyle.setVerticalAlignment(HSSFCellStyle.VERTICAL_CENTER);改成:cellStyle.setVerticalAlignmen
2022-01-11 11:24:18
420
原创 该服务器支持最多2100个参数,拆分任务分步查询
遇到个问题,需要修改个功能这个mapper里面传的参数非常多有可能6000以上,直接传就报错了报错信息如下在这里插入代码片### Error querying database. Cause: com.microsoft.sqlserver.jdbc.SQLServerException: 传入的请求具有过多的参数。该服务器支持最多 2100 个参数。请减少参数的数目,然后重新发送该请求。### The error occurred while setting parameters### SQL
2021-10-29 10:48:41
1177
原创 git报错 ! [rejected] dev -> dev (non-fast-forward)
两种情况1.第一次提交检出的,因为两个分支没有关联,在原有命令后加–allow-unrelated-histories//提交git push 仓库别名 分支 --allow-unrelated-histories//捡出git pull 仓库别名 分支 --allow-unrelated-histories2.已经进行过git操作的,已经有关联的//获取远程dev分支的修改git fetch 仓库别名 分支 // 合并远程dev分支git merge 仓库别名 分支 // 更新本地
2021-10-12 10:17:26
2511
原创 git报错 - Your branch and ‘xxx/xxx‘ have diverged
报这个错就是因为你和远程库出现分叉了#mermaid-svg-ZdbbzsJbovzlW6jG .label{font-family:'trebuchet ms', verdana, arial;font-family:var(--mermaid-font-family);fill:#333;color:#333}#mermaid-svg-ZdbbzsJbovzlW6jG .label text{fill:#333}#mermaid-svg-ZdbbzsJbovzlW6jG .node rect,#m.
2021-09-23 15:25:22
1296
原创 git报错 - src refspec dev does not match any failed to push some refs to
push的时候报错src refspec dev does not match any 本地没有dev分支,建一个dev分支就行,分支新建、查看命令
2021-09-22 16:19:11
424
原创 git大全
鉴于自己背不下来太多git语句,所以留个备忘,将会持续更新一、没有git,从下载git开始暂无,明天再补,累了下面的内容需要现有个概念,一个是本地仓库一个是远程仓库,想往远程仓库某个分支里推内容,需要先有本地仓库跟远程的连接起来,就是新建本地仓库(本篇文章中的五>1或者3)。然后还要有对应分支,你想往远程的dev里传本地里就得有个dev分支(本篇文章中的四)。之后就可以开始拉取提交等操作了。二、拉取相关暂无,明天再补,累了三、提交相关正常提交1.git add .2.git .
2021-09-22 16:16:24
291
原创 非父子组件传值、兄弟组件传值(mitt使用手册)
vue升3.X之后去掉了 $ on,$ offf,$once,所以就在这里记录一下用第三方插件mitt来传值1.安装mitt模块//cmdnpm install --save mitt2.新建一个文件实例化mitt//model/event.jsimport mitt from 'mitt'const event = mitt();export default event;3.实现header给传footer传值//header.vue<template>&l.
2021-08-06 13:41:08
625
原创 vue父子组件之间传值、父组件传子组件、子组件传父组件
先画个对应关系后面的基于这个,父main子header一、父组件传给子组件、子组件获取父组件1. props这种方式不支持子组件更改父组件的值,想改,这个下面有个$parent用他//main.vue<template> <c-header :user="user"></c-header>//:子组件接收值="data里的值" //要是要传的多,又有数据又想调方法,那就直接给实例传过去 <c-header :main="this"><.
2021-08-06 11:08:22
187
原创 TypeScript 配置自动编译(tsconfig.json生成)
1.项目路径下//cmd里tsc --init2.把自动生成的tsconfig.json中的outDir改了路径,不改也行,有注释就解开3.vscode里终端 ->运行任务 ->TypeScript ->tsc:监视 - tsconfig.json以上操作后保存之后就不用在去敲 tsc 文件名来编译了...
2021-07-29 10:39:13
1058
原创 路由懒加载
路由懒加载的实际就是提高客户使用体验不懒加载:打包之后将所有的业务代码整合在dist/js/app.…….js,业务逻辑越多这个js越大。每次请求时间越长,所以进行路由懒加载,将这个js分开,一个业务逻辑的js是一个打完包的js客户点击某个路由就只掉这个打完包的js。//router/index//引入组件的方式改一下就可以//原先import myPlant from '../components/dispatch/myPlant'//现在改成以下这种const myPlant = () =&
2021-07-09 09:11:16
95
原创 动态路由传值
//router/index{ path: '/user/:abc', component: User, }, //User.vue <h1>{{userId}}</h1> <script> export default { computed:{ userId(){ return this.$route.param.abc//$route获取到正在活跃的路由 } }}</script>...
2021-07-08 16:16:14
263
原创 VUE地址栏中跳转总有#号
项目里的地址栏中总会有#号显示,取消掉它//路由配置indexconst router = new VueRouter({ routes mode:'history'//默认是hash,hash就会有#})
2021-07-08 11:18:15
1310
原创 好用的编程辅助软件
对于以下推荐辅助软件的使用,我也并没有发挥到极致,只是说自己使用起来方便,感兴趣的话还是要自己下载再摸索一下截屏软件 Snipaste我认为他最好用的功能1.可以截屏后置顶图片,不用来回切换2.可以直接在截图内部进行取色3.聊天工具截图带的功能他都有并且标注种类更丰富Snipaste下载官网盘符搜索 Everything电脑里面东西多,除了刚启动第一次搜索比较慢之外,搜索电脑里东西都挺快的,也能将搜到的直接打开路径,初步满足我的需求Everything下载官网配色工具 ColorSc
2021-06-29 15:26:32
242
原创 VUE导出Excel
安装依赖 npm install -S file-saver xlsx npm install -D script-loader下载js(Blob.js、Export2Excel.js)
2021-06-28 14:28:48
113
原创 webpack安装配置
一. 先看装没装Node.jsnode -v二.全局安装webpackvue cli2依赖3.6.0版本vue cli 3及以上就安最新就行npm install webpack@3.6.0 -g//检查是否安装成功webpack --version三.配置webpack.config.js解决webpack打包的时候每次都要写打包哪个文件到哪//为了解决每次都写这个webpack ./src/main.js ./dist/bundle.js//改成写```javascri
2021-06-18 09:55:36
109
原创 antd按需加载
使用react-app-rewired安装依赖npm i react-app-rewired@2.0.2-next.0 babel-plugin-import customize-cra这个时候就会有一个比较大的坑,react-app-rewired必须制定版本,否则报错修改启动方式,在package.json中原版“scripts”: {“start”: “react-scripts start”,“build”: “react-scripts build”,“test”: “react
2021-05-10 17:05:13
772
转载 如何运行vue项目
首先,列出来我们需要的东西:node.js环境(npm包管理器)vue-cli 脚手架构建工具cnpm npm的淘宝镜像安装node.js从node.js官网下载并安装node,安装过程很简单,一路“下一步”就可以了(傻瓜式安装)。安装完成之后,打开命令行工具,输入 node -v,如下图,如果出现相应的版本号,则说明安装成功。npm包管理器,是集成在node中的,所以,直接输入...
2019-11-18 16:02:35
171
转载 删除数据库中的表及表内数据
如果要删除数据表中所有数据只要遍历一下数据库再删除就可以了,清除所有数据我们可以使用搜索出所有表名,构造为一条SQL语句进行清除了,这里我一一给各位同学介绍。使用sql删除数据库中所有表是不难的,就是遍历一下数据库中所有用户表,并将它清除,下边是具体的sql语句,在关键部分已经作了详细的注释:代码如下–变量@tablename保存表名declare @tablename nvarchar(...
2019-07-18 15:33:53
835
原创 new Vue() 和 export default {}的区别
new Vue() 和 export default {} 的区别Vue 就是一个构造函数,生成的实例是一个巨大的对象,可以包含数据、模板、挂载元素、方法、生命周期钩子等选项。所以渲染的时候,可以使用构造 Vue 实例的方式来渲染相应的 html 页面:new Vue({ el: '#app' ...})而export default{}是在复用组件的时候用到的。在一个...
2019-06-17 10:42:38
365
原创 npm run dev 报错:missing script:dev
npm run dev 报错:missing script:dev查找之后发现打开的项目中的package.json中的scripts没有dev ,而是serve。所以应该是 npm run serve运行vue项目。按照ip或者localhost就能打开网页啦...
2019-06-12 16:25:07
391
原创 [Vue warn]: Cannot find element: #vue-app报错解决
公司最近来了新员工,遇到[Vue warn]: Cannot find element: #vue-app这个报错问我,我也一起解决了好久,再次记录一下,防止再犯new vue({})的外部js,例如叫app.js要最后引入,因为要先有id为vue-app的div,vue才能获取相应的元素。否则会报错: [Vue warn]: Cannot find element: #vue-app...
2019-06-12 09:08:34
5088
3
原创 vue脚手架环境配置
vue环境配置1.登录https://nodejs.org/en/,点击框中按钮,安装在电脑上。2.验证是否装上cmd中调整到安装路径cmd中node空格 -v 回车有版本号(已安装上)...
2019-06-10 15:11:03
267
Export2Excel.js
2021-06-28
Excel导出功能中Blob.js
2021-06-28
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人